i sleepwalk and also talk in my sleep, apparently its quite funny for other people to hear me chatting. but now my 3yr old dd has started sleepwalking. she comes to me wide awake, i just lead her back to bed and put her back in where she promptly goes back to sleep. sometimes she talk to me whilst she is sleepwalking, tonight she came out and said 'help me' but was obviously not awake and with it as there was nothing she needed help with.
she talks a lot in her sleep too, it can be very disturbing to hear her chatting in her sleep at silly hours of the night, its usually just rubbish and muttering, but sometimes she sounds so frightened that i go and check on her, but again she is definaltly asleep. does anyone know why she is doing this? is she having bad dreams or is it something i will just have to get used to?

My dd1 started talking in her sleep at about 3 and now dd2 (3 and 4ms) has been doing it for a couple of months. It is disturbing to hear them muttering away isn't it!! Dd1 also has quite bad night terrors at this age, and dd2 has the odd bad night. I thought it was to do with when their imagination kicks off, they have alot going on in their days and process it in their sleep. With both of mine it's happened around the time when they started alot of imaginary play. It eased with dd1 after about 6ms, but she does do it now and again, if she's got something "going on" e.g. school play/trip etc. Homeopathy definitely helped ease the night terrors for us, so it may help your dd with sleep walking/talking??
